Three-bedroom end-terrace home in a quiet cul-de-sac location near Hereford city centre | Neutrally decorated throughout with gas central heating and double glazing | Spacious living room with large front window offering plenty of natural light | Kitchen/dining room to the rear with French doors to the garden | Enclosed flat rear garden | Sold with No Onward Chain Located in the popular residential area of Whitecross, just half a mile west of the city centre of Hereford. Nearby are excellent local amenities to include local shop, post office, church, public house and primary & secondary schooling, whilst more extensive amenities can be found in the city centre, within walking distance and with regular bus services. Situated in a quiet residential cul-de-sac near the city of Hereford, 7 Tennyson Close is a well-presented three-bedroom end-of-terrace home offering comfortable family living in a convenient location. The property is approached via steps from the roadside with on-street parking available. A neatly hedged frontage features a lawned garden with decorative shrubs, and a side gate offers access to the rear garden. Inside, the home is neutrally decorated throughout and benefits from gas central heating and double glazing. The entrance hall leads to a generous living room with a large front-facing window, filling the space with natural light. To the rear, a spacious kitchen/dining room provides an ideal setting for family meals, complete with shaker-style units, laminate worktops, integrated single oven and gas hob, and plumbing for both a dishwasher and washing machine. French doors open out to the garden, enhancing the connection between indoor and outdoor living. Upstairs, the property offers two good-sized double bedrooms and a single bedroom, which features a built-in single bed cleverly positioned over the stair bulkhead. A modern family bathroom is finished with a white three-piece suite and a shower over the bath. To the rear, the enclosed garden is mainly laid to lawn with a paved patio perfect for outdoor dining, and a separate concrete area ideal for a garden shed or additional seating.
